Help Your Criminal Lawyer To Help You

Human daily lives are, directly or indirectly, under the effects of the legal laws and who knows you might need a Criminal Lawyer one day. Though it happens in the entire world, not many of us realize it. Very small things like smoking cigarettes and huge thing like purchasing a property are all ruled by legal system. The world is growing in complexity. There are bad relationships, new technologies, and financial loss. These things can make good people making mistakes and finally in need of aid from professional criminal defense lawyer. Yet, no attorney can create a good resolution on their own. Those attorneys will need total collaboration with the client. This way, the door to get best defenses is opened widely.
Quality time: The simplest effort that one can attribute to help the defense attorney is making and attending an appointment to discuss every aspect of the case. For your information, many juvenile and circuit in America show how ignorance a client might be. Many clients of those cases refused to attend the meeting that their client has set.
So, try to come to every appointment that your lawyer has made, it would be great if you also ready to talk about all details, related documents, and witnesses of your case with your attorney. We all are aware that lawyers are very busy people. Thus, if you have the reason to fail to come on the expected meeting, call the attorney and reschedule another meeting. Last minute before the trial begins is never a suitable time for you to make initial meeting with the attorney.
Be honest: When you talk to your attorney, remember that he or she is not you parent, your friend, or your priest. Thus, you must not make any exaggeration, change, or justification to the fact. Only tell them things that you remember honestly. Also remember that the attorney is on your side, they will help you finding the available defenses, giving advices on your case, and inform you about possible resolution.
There is a formula about honesty in this matter: the more honest you are to your lawyer, the higher the possibility that your attorney find the best defense for you. Alternatively, if you prefer to lie, you risk yourself losing the case because you have broken the trust between you and your attorney.
Everything can be evidence: Criminal laws often ignore the right and the wrong. In front of the laws, the only helpful things are constitutional questions, witness credibility, and best evidence. Often, the resolution of criminal trial is determined by the ability of the witness to tell a good story with more consistency in providing facts.
You are supposed to help your criminal defense attorney by giving them everything about the case including witnesses, supporting info, and alibis. If you are not even close to the crime scene when the crime happened, proof it. There is a lot of things that you can use as evidence such as toll slips, restaurants receipts, property titles, contracts, and statements from colleagues.
If you are physically unable of doing a crime that is accused to you, you must still be careful. Have a serious consultation with your attorney. You are not in a fairy tale world.
